PROSPECTS OF AUTOMATION IN MACHINING STEEL PLATES BY LASER BEAM
The use of lasers in metalworking is becoming more and more important. This new technology is coming out from experimental stage of technical feasibility and today the industrial laser applications are becoming various and numerous. Particularly in sheet metal working, laser peculiarities and advantages are very interesting. In cutting and welding the flexibility of laser beam allows to work rapidly and precisely components of different and complex geometries. For cutting applications are generally used laser sources at low and medium power level and technological problems are relatively simple. Different systems for plate or tridimensional sheet cutting are now available. The welding technology involves more problems not only for metallurgical quality but also for system architecture.
